“More often than not, nothingness is reluctantly and despairingly taken to be the only hypothesis possible when all the others have failed, since by definition it cannot be disproven and is beyond the scope of reason.”

Georges Bernanos

About This Quote

When other explanations fail, people may accept nothingness as the only answer, though it cannot be disproven and lies beyond reason.

In simple terms: Nothingness is a default when other ideas fail.
